Webstd::map is a sorted associative container that contains key-value pairs with unique keys. Keys are sorted by using the comparison function Compare.Search, removal, and insertion operations have logarithmic complexity. Maps are usually implemented as red-black trees.. WebThe constructor of the new element (i.e. std::pair) is called with exactly the same arguments as supplied to emplace, forwarded via std::forward(args)... . The element may be constructed even if there already is an element with the key in the container, in which case the newly constructed element will be destroyed immediately. WebThe complexity guarantees of all standard containers are specified in the C++ Standard.. std::unordered_map element access and element insertion is required to be of complexity O(1) on average and O(N) worst case (cf. Sections 23.5.4.3 and 23.5.4.4; pages 797-798).. A specific implementation (that is, a specific vendor's implementation of the Standard …
